Position Summary:The Head of Navigation Digital, R&D will lead software and systems engineering for intra operative navigation: localization, registration, sensor fusion, and orchestration across embedded, edge and cloud components. Act as the primary navigation partner to robotics, clinical, and regulatory teams to deliver deterministic, clinician grade navigation capabilities. You will be responsible for: Own multi-year navigation SW & systems roadmap and drive delivery to product milestones. Architect real-time navigation stacks and partition deterministic control loops from non-real-time services. Lead SW, algorithm and AI teams to productionize perception pipelines. Build and operate simulation/digital-twin and synthetic data pipelines for validation and regression testing. Establish IEC 62304-aligned software lifecycle, CI/ CD for embedded cloud, automated test harnesses, and traceability. Define non-functional requirements (accuracy budgets, latency, availability, robustness) and verification strategies. Integrate ML - Ops for model training, validation, deployment controls, and in-field monitoring. Partner with QA/ RA to deliver software evidence, risk controls and regulatory inputs; qualify navigation software suppliers/ SDKs. Partner with technology partners for co-development. Qualifications / Requirements:Required. BS/ MS in Computer Science, Robotics, Systems or equivalent.~10 years SW/systems experience with ~5 years in navigation/perception or related systems; experience shipping production navigation or perception software. Strong C/ C and Python, real-time middleware (ROS/ ROS 2, DDS or equivalent), sensor fusion, SLAM/ VO, 3 D registration, and simulation tooling. Practical experience with software design controls for regulated products (IEC 62304, ISO 13485, ISO 14971). Systems thinker with hands-on credibility; mentors senior engineers, builds cross-disciplinary trust, and navigates clinical/regulatory constraints. Collaborates globally with external partners and sales regions. Preferred. Surgical/orthopedics navigation experience, GPU/accelerator optimization, and ML model lifecycle in regulated contexts. Experience with SBOM, cybersecurity for medical devices, and cloud/edge orchestration.
